Obituary of Elsie Baird

Elsie Gertrude Baird, 82, of Waterloo, Ontario, passed away on January 15, 2021 at the Palliative Care Unit, Freeport Hospital.

 

Elsie was born in Waterloo, Ontario to Michael and Elizabeth Stix on December 2, 1938. She was a graduate of Kitchener-Waterloo Collegiate and Vocational School. She was a proud homemaker and enjoyed volunteering at Knox Presbyterian Church where she was an Elder, taught Sunday school and sang in the choir as well as volunteering with the Canadian Cancer Society. Throughout her life she enjoyed her church groups, tennis, book clubs, her wonderful group of friends, traveling and visiting with her grandchildren.

 

Elsie is survived by her high school sweetheart and husband, William Patrick (Pat) Baird of Waterloo, with whom she enjoyed a warm and loving marriage of 62 years.  She is lovingly remembered by Cindy (daughter) and Jim Gaffney of Louisville, KY and Scott (son) and Marcia Baird of Waterloo. Her grandchildren, Sean, Austyn and Connor Gaffney and Hunter Baird will miss her laughter and her hugs. She is also survived by Carl (brother) and Diane Stix, Edward (brother) and Marjorie Stix, both of Waterloo as well as many nieces and nephews. She is predeceased by her parents, her brother, Bill Stix and her sister, Elizabeth (Liz) Ford.
